Charge Nurse

Cape Health Surgery Center is hiring a Charge Nurse. Welcome to Cape Health Surgery Center. At Cape Health Surgery Center, we believe health and care are inseparable. We focus on offering a high quality, service-oriented environment for your surgical procedure.

Position Responsibilities
  • Supervises the OR staff to provide a daily smooth flow of cases.
  • Assists in coordination of daily case scheduling in the O.R. with other staff to ensure schedule will flow smoothly (O.R. & X-Ray).
  • Prepares monthly call schedules.
  • Prepare, coordinate and perform monthly O.R. staff meetings for all OR, radiology, and anesthesia techs.
  • Communicate effectively with physicians to resolve issues and provide efficiency and smooth case flow.
  • Orders instruments and equipment for cases.
  • Coordinate inventory quarterly in all areas of the OR.
  • Assists with OR education by coordinating and/or giving in-services.
  • Prepare schedules in the afternoon for next day.
  • Supervise the evening shift which includes coordination of the staff for case completions of the day and setting up for the next day. This also includes Radiology.
  • Communicate with physicians to resolve equipment or instrument issues by coordinating ordering or getting repairs done.
  • Communicate with vendors and representatives for supplies, equipment or instruments that are needed for cases.
  • Works closely with Materials and Sterile Processing Dept to coordinate supplies & instrument needs.
  • Preparing and administering annual evaluations.
  • Works closely with manager with hiring and orienting OR staff members.
  • Helps in revising and preparing policies that relate to O.R. functions.
  • Assistance in maintaining compliance for Joint Commission surveys.
  • Enters company data collections and observations with company EDGE.
  • MIDAS data entry.
  • Enters data into Kronos time keeping program.
  • Assistance with staff counseling as necessary.
  • Coordinates and assists in Performance Improvement Projects.
Qualifications
  • Graduate of accredited school or professional nursing.
  • Baccalaureate degree preferred or work related experience.
  • Three (3) years experience in surgery.
  • Current Florida RN License.
  • BLS, ACLS and PALS required.
  • CNOR preferred.
  • Independent decision making skills.
  • Ability to prioritize and handle multiple projects.
  • Excellent communication skills with staff, physicians, patients, families and vendors.
